The coworking industry continues to evolve, driven by changes in work culture, technology advancements, and shifting business needs. As we move into 2024, several key trends are shaping the future of coworking spaces. These trends reflect the growing demand for flexible work environments, enhanced member experiences, and sustainable practices. Here are the top five coworking trends to watch for in 2024.
Top Coworking Trends of 2024
1. Hybrid Work Models and Flexibility
The Rise of Hybrid Work
The COVID-19 pandemic has permanently altered the way people work, leading to the widespread adoption of hybrid work models. In 2024, this trend is expected to continue as companies embrace a mix of remote and in-office work. Coworking spaces are uniquely positioned to accommodate hybrid work arrangements, offering flexible, on-demand workspaces that can be easily scaled up or down.
Benefits of Flexibility
Flexibility is one of the primary reasons professionals are drawn to coworking spaces. In 2024, coworking providers will continue to offer a variety of membership options, including day passes, part-time memberships, and pay-as-you-go plans. This flexibility allows individuals and businesses to adapt their workspace needs to their specific requirements, whether they need a quiet place to work for a few hours or a dedicated office for a growing team.
The Role of Technology
Technology will play a crucial role in supporting hybrid work models. Coworking spaces will increasingly integrate digital tools and platforms to streamline the booking process, manage space utilization, and facilitate virtual collaboration. This includes mobile apps for reserving desks and meeting rooms, as well as advanced video conferencing systems to connect remote and in-person team members seamlessly.
2. Wellness and Well-Being Initiatives
Prioritizing Health and Wellness
Wellness has become a significant focus in the workplace, and coworking spaces are no exception. In 2024, we can expect coworking providers to enhance their wellness offerings, creating environments that support their members’ physical and mental well-being. This trend is driven by the growing recognition that a healthy workforce is more productive and engaged.
Wellness-Focused Amenities
Coworking spaces will offer a range of wellness-focused amenities, such as fitness centers, yoga studios, meditation rooms, and on-site nutritionists. These amenities provide members with convenient access to health and wellness resources, promoting a balanced lifestyle. Additionally, coworking spaces may organize wellness programs, workshops, and fitness classes to encourage healthy habits and foster a sense of community.
Designing for Wellness
The design of coworking spaces will also reflect a commitment to wellness. Expect to see more biophilic design elements, such as natural lighting, indoor plants, and open spaces that connect members with nature. Ergonomic furniture, adjustable standing desks, and quiet zones will become standard features, creating a comfortable and supportive work environment.
3. Niche and Specialized Coworking Spaces
Catering to Specific Industries and Interests
As the coworking market becomes more saturated, providers are increasingly differentiating themselves by catering to specific industries, professions, or interests. Niche coworking spaces offer tailored amenities, services, and communities that meet the unique needs of their target members.
This trend is set to grow in 2024 as coworking spaces seek to attract and retain a diverse range of professionals.
Examples of Niche Spaces
- Tech-Focused Spaces: Coworking spaces designed for tech startups and developers, equipped with high-speed internet, coding resources, and networking events with industry experts.
- Creative Hubs: Spaces that cater to artists, designers, and writers, offering studios, workshops, and galleries to showcase their work.
- Healthcare and Wellness: Coworking environments for health professionals, including therapy rooms, wellness clinics, and spaces for fitness instructors.
- Social Enterprises: Spaces dedicated to nonprofits and social enterprises, providing resources for community impact and social innovation.
Building Community
Niche coworking spaces foster a strong sense of community by bringing together like-minded individuals who share common interests and goals. These spaces often host industry-specific events, mentorship programs, and collaborative projects, creating opportunities for members to learn from each other and grow their networks.
4. Sustainability and Green Practices
Growing Importance of Sustainability
Sustainability is becoming a top priority for businesses and individuals alike. In 2024, coworking spaces will continue to adopt green practices and eco-friendly designs to reduce their environmental impact. This trend reflects a broader shift towards sustainability in the workplace and the desire to create healthier, more sustainable environments.
Sustainable Design and Construction
Coworking spaces will incorporate sustainable design principles, such as energy-efficient lighting, water-saving fixtures, and the use of recycled or locally sourced materials. Green building certifications, such as L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design), will become more common, signaling a commitment to environmental responsibility.
Operational Practices
In addition to sustainable design, coworking spaces will implement green operational practices. This includes waste reduction and recycling programs, composting initiatives, and efforts to minimize single-use plastics. Some spaces may offer incentives for members who use public transportation or cycle to work, further promoting sustainable habits.
Wellness and Sustainability
Sustainability and wellness are closely linked, and coworking spaces will emphasize the connection between the two. For example, spaces with ample natural light, good air quality, and eco-friendly materials contribute to both environmental sustainability and members’ well-being.
5. Advanced Technology Integration
Embracing Innovation
Technology is transforming the coworking industry, and in 2024, we will see even greater integration of advanced technologies to enhance the member experience. From smart office solutions to AI-driven insights, coworking spaces will leverage innovation to improve efficiency, connectivity, and convenience.
Smart Office Solutions
Smart office solutions will become more prevalent, including IoT (Internet of Things) devices that monitor and manage energy use, lighting, and climate control. These technologies can create more comfortable and efficient work environments, as well as provide valuable data on space utilization and member preferences.
AI and Data Analytics
Artificial intelligence and data analytics will play a significant role in coworking spaces. AI-powered tools can help manage bookings, optimize space layouts, and predict future needs based on member behavior. Data analytics will provide insights into how spaces are used, allowing providers to make informed decisions and continually improve their offerings.
Enhanced Connectivity
High-speed internet and reliable connectivity are essential for modern workspaces. In 2024, coworking spaces will invest in advanced networking infrastructure, including 5G capabilities and robust cybersecurity measures, to ensure seamless and secure connectivity for all members.
Virtual and Augmented Reality
Virtual and augmented reality technologies will also make their way into coworking spaces, offering new ways to collaborate and engage. VR and AR can be used for virtual tours, immersive presentations, and interactive training sessions, providing members with innovative tools to enhance their work.
